
Description Andrew Schuon has served on our Board since January 1998. Since 2008, Mr. Schuon has served as a co-founder of ?C? Student Entertainment, a boutique radio and mobile-focused media company. Since January 2009, Mr. Schuon has been a senior executive of Live Nation Entertainment, Inc., having started with Ticketmaster Entertainment, Inc. prior to the company?s January 2010 merger with Live Nation, Inc. Since 2008, he has served as President of Beat Advisors, Inc, a consulting firm specializing in television, radio, out of home, retail, and hotel/casino entertainment programming solutions. From July 2004 to January 2008, Mr. Schuon served as founder and President of Vivendi/Universal?s IMF: The International Music Feed, a 24-hour cable TV channel. From August 2002 to February 2004, Mr. Schuon was President of Programming of Infinity Broadcasting. From April 2001 to August 2002, he was President and Chief Executive Officer of Pressplay, a joint venture created by Sony Music Entertainment and Universal Music Group. From December 1999 to April 2001, Mr. Schuon was President and Chief Operating Officer of the Universal Music Group?s music business, Farmclub.com, Inc. From February 1998 to November 1999, Mr. Schuon was Executive Vice President/General Manager of Warner Bros. Records Inc. From 1992 to December 1997, Mr. Schuon served as Executive Vice President of MTV where he was responsible for programming, music, production and talent for the MTV and VH1 cable channels.
